Khokhai - Chhabra, Baran

Khokhai is a village situated in the Chhabra tehsil of Baran district, Rajasthan. It is located approximately 9 km from the tehsil headquarters in Chhabra and around 59 km from the district headquarters in Baran. Googor serves as the Gram Panchayat for Khokhai village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Khokhai is 103417. The village covers a total geographical area of 380 hectares and falls under the 325220 pincode. Chhabra is the nearest town, located about 9 km away.

Khokhai village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Khokhai

According to the 2011 Census, Khokhai village had a total population of 109 people, including 57 males and 52 females, living in 19 households. The sex ratio was 912 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 58.54%, with male literacy at 85.00% and female literacy at 33.33%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 20,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 60.

Transport and Connectivity of Khokhai

Khokhai is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Chhabra Gugor, while the nearest airport is Kota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 91.5 km.
